Classes for Students with Deaf or Hard of Hearing Disabilities

For students whose primary disability is a moderate to profound hearing loss and who do not attend their neighborhood schools or the California School for the Deaf at Fremont, we offer special day classes and interpreter support. Due to the low number of students in the county with this disability, only two classes are operated. Our interpreters use ASL sign language as their primary form of communication, though SEE sign and other forms may be used to meet the needs of the individual students.
